Abstract
The immobilization of lactate dehydrogenase (LDH) on electrochemically poly merized polypyrrole - polyvinylsulphonate (PPY-PVS) films has been accompli shed via cross-linking technique using glutaraldehyde. The characterization of the LDH-immobilized PPY-PVS films has been carried out using FTIR and c yclic voltammetry. These PPY-PVS-LDH electrodes are shown to have a detecti on limit of 1 x 10(-4) M, a response time of about 40 s, and a shelf-life o f about 2 weeks and these can be used for L-lactate estimation from 0.5 to 6 mM.
